Arreat Summit suggests that crafted items have the capacity to be even more powerful than unique items. As a result, I'm not sure whether I should spend my time on getting the right ingredients for a crafted item, vs. using those ingredients in a socketed item and waiting for a unique item.
Does anyone have any experience in comparing high level crafted items vs. unique items?

To OP: if you should compare something like a caster belt with arachnid mesh you'd have to look at the rest of your equipment too, some strive for getting their character reaching different breakpoints like FHR and FCR. Lets look at arachnid mesh and later compare it with a nice caster belt,
it's got
+1 to skills, very important to a caster
20% FCR, very important to a caster
Defense, too low to be of any importance.
Increases Maximum Mana 5%, nice but not affected by battle orders.
Venom charges (eh??)
Now a caster belt
5-10% FCR not as much as Aracnid, but if you can get other sources for the last FCR bp (to have some value it has to have 10% FCR)
10-20 mana, also not as much as Arachnid but better than nothing (max on caster belts would be 20 if you rolled serpents prefix in the craft)
regen mana 4-10%, something arachnid does not have and might be helpful in some situations
Now to what in my opinion a good caster belt should have (in addition to the stuff above):
24% Faster Hit recovery, this can be the difference between life or death in some situations, its justto reach that break point.
+50-60 life, massive amount of life
Bonus:
up to 30% to a single resist (light resist against those souls)
up to 200% enhanced defense (less chance to get hit, only good on a vampirefang belt)
up to 30 strength (bring on that high strength req equip)
Replenish life up to +10
(remember that a crafted item can only get 4 affixes in addition to those 3 modifiers they always get)

crafting, to my mind, is a way of useing up pgems, low runes and junk jewels.
sure, you MIGHT get something super-omfgodly, but chances are higher you'll craft your way through a few mules worth of supplies and still not have anything "worthwhile" to show for it.
i use crafted caster ammy's on my 200 fcr fire sorc (either a 20fcr/minor res or a +1fire/19fcr/minor res one, depending if i'm chasing 142fhr at the time or not) and on my ww/trap'sin (with circlet/arach/trangs gloves, i only need 5% fcr on my ammy, so any +'sin crafted ammy will hit the BP. i also have a +1'sin/15fcr/res ammy i use with an FCR ring when i need to ditch the Arach for more %DR).
one day, i might have a crack at Blood Hats too. 10%DS/2sox/visionary/+2barb/+20dex would make a useful hat for a BvB methinks.
Crafting uses low end runes, jewels with little or no use and the pgems, which are probably the hardest part to get (at least in single player). Pgems DO pile up, however, and rather quickly. I always collect every flawless gem, every rune Tal and above, and every jewel. I never seem to have enough, because I'm more or less addicted to crafting. Sure, 99% of the results are useless, of low use, or decent, but once in a while, I get something that's so good that it's worth building an entire character around. One example which comes to mind is a 2pala 20fcr 14dex amu. The other mods could have been better, but this amulet allows for a max block 125%fcr hammerdin with ALL stat points in vita (using other great crafts providing str while I wait forever for Jah and Ber....).
